That's the world of Electric Lady Lab, a musical duo that rocketed out of Denmark in 2009, taking the music scene by storm. Consisting of Mette Lindberg and Niclas Petersen, these artists combine infectious pop hooks with electronica, crafting a unique blend of modern nostalgia that resonates with listeners who yearn for a little retro in their playlists.
